Quick and Easy Steps to Connect Your Nintendo Switch
First things first, take your Nintendo Switch console out of the box. You will find the main unit, two Joy-Con controllers, a dock, an HDMI cable, and a power adapter. That’s all you need to get started!
Next, if you want to play on your TV, grab the HDMI cable and plug one end into the dock and the other end into your TV. Then, slide the main Switch unit into the dock until you feel it click into place. Plug the power adapter into the dock and then into an outlet. Turn on your TV, select the correct HDMI input, and voila! You should see your Nintendo Switch home screen ready to go. If you’re on the move, just attach the Joy-Cons to the side of the main unit, and you can start playing in handheld mode immediately.
